Application Requirements
Applicants must have completed the Higher School Certificate (or equivalent) with a minimum of 50 points, including English (Band 4) and Mathematics (Band 3). Applicants must also have an ATAR of 75 or above. Applicants who do not meet the ATAR requirement may be considered for admission based on their academic transcript and other factors. In addition to the academic requirements, applicants must also demonstrate a strong interest in linguistics and a commitment to research. Applicants are encouraged to submit a personal statement that outlines their reasons for wanting to study linguistics at Macquarie University. Macquarie University also offers a number of scholarships for students who are interested in studying linguistics. These scholarships are awarded based on academic merit and financial need.
